
A training course to help churches support bereaved people
The Bereavement Care Awareness course has been produced as part of Care for the Family’s bereavement training for churches. It is useful for clergy, church leaders, pastoral care leaders or any volunteer interested in supporting bereaved people – whether they are already engaged in bereavement support or are considering the possibility of developing it.
